Youngstown State University is Hiring a Reference Librarian, Health and Human Services Near Youngstown, OH

Summary of Position

To provide, research assistance and instruction to patrons in all subject areas of Maag Library with a special emphasis on assistance in the disciplines relating to Health and Human Services.

Position Information

Essential Functions and Responsibilities: Assists all library patrons in library use and in identifying and accessing information relevant to their needs.
Serves as a library liaison to the College of Health and Human Services.
Establishes collaborative relationships with faculty, staff and students and develop services, resources, and initiatives to advance teaching, learning and research. Contacts faculty at least once a year to suggest services or collaboration.
Develops, teaches, and evaluates learning outcomes, instructional tools, web-based resources, and assessments for informational literacy to a diverse community of students and faculty.
Works with faculty and staff to develop collections and resources supporting academic programs.
Maintains an awareness of contemporary and historical information resources critical to the University’s scholarly programs.
Develops and maintains web-based resources (subject guides, class pages, instructional tools, etc.) in assigned subject areas and related programs.
Participates in public services rotation work including evenings and weekends.
Compiles necessary statistics and prepares reports for YSU schools, departments, regional accrediting agencies, state agencies and/or professional organizations.
Conducts library research as appropriate or as directed.
Serves on committees or functional teams as necessary or as directed.

Other Functions and Responsibilities:
Performs other related duties as assigned.

Equipment Operated:
Computer and all other standard office equipment.

Work Schedule:
Typically, M-T-W-Th-F 8: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.

Supervision Exercised:
May exercise supervision over student employees.

Reports to
. Co-Director & Head of Research and Academic Support.

Qualifications and Competencies

Required Certifications, Training, and/or Licensures: None

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:
Knowledge of: University policies and procedures*; office practices and procedures; department/division goals and objectives*; department/division policies and procedures*; workplace safety practices and procedures*; English grammar and spelling; records management; office management; project management; of information literacy issues in a higher education environment.
Skill in: Use of office equipment; typing, data entry; computer operation; use of computer software and other programs applicable to the assigned department/division*; proficient with disciplinary research databases such as CINAHL, MEDLINE, Nursing@Ovid, PubMed, and ProQuest.
Ability to: Coll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ions; determine material and equipment needs; compile and prepare reports; use proper research methods to gather data; understand a variety of written and/or verbal communications; maintain records according to established procedures; effectively interact with personnel and public to answer routine questions; train or instruct others; move quickly and effectively from one tasks to another; work independently and in a team environment; develop and maintain effective working relationships; teach research concepts and skills both in-person and online to a diverse user community.
(*) Developed after employment.

Minimum Qualifications:
Master’s degree in Library Science from an American Library Association (ALA) accredited institution.

Preferred Qualifications:
Additional degree in health sciences or a related field; experience in liaison work with health professionals and/or health organizations; experience in teaching and preparing course materials.
